Web02. sep 2009. · This is a grating ruled on a concave spherical mirror, in consequence of which it has a self-focusing property and needs no other optical component to produce a spectrum from a point or short line source. It is the invention of H. A. Rowland of Johns Hopkins University who gave an account of it in 1883. WebConcave gratings are curved and therefore either converge or diverge light. This can be useful for reducing the total number of optical components needed in a system, but the focal properties of the system will be wavelength-dependent. WebConcave holographic gratings function as both a dispersing and focusing element in monochromators and spectrographs. These gratings contain two focusing elements: the substrate, and the groove curvature.
